Does it matter what kind of trans fluid you use in automatic?
Even if you change your transmission fluid, you never will be able to drain all of the fluid from your system so it is important to use the same kind of fluid. It is also important to use the correct type of automatic transmission fluid because different fluids have very different properties.

Can you mix regular transmission fluid with synthetic fluid?
Is it OK to mix synthetic ATF with a conventional and/or synthetic blend ATF? Yes. Synthetic ATF and conventional fluids are 100 percent compatible with each other.
Where is the transmission dipstick on a 2007 Suzuki XL7?
How do you check the transmission fluid levels in a 2007 suzuki XL7? The dipstick – if you want to call it that, is down down down on the front of the transmission. It has a yeollow handle on it. You have to unscrew a 10mm bolt first that locks it in place, and then pull the stick out.

Is it safe to use automatic transmission fluid as an engine flush?
Is it safe to use automatic transmission fluid as an engine flush? Since automatic transmission fluids contain detergents and help fight sludge, some enthusiasts add a small amount to their motor oil prior to changing oil as a way to clean accumulated deposits and dissolve sludge.
